VS Series


Panasonic S Series Type V electrolytic capacitors feature endurance of 2000 hours at +85°C.

AEC-Q200 qualified (some deviations apply)
High ripple current
High reliability
Low impedance
Long life
Surface mount

Applications


Panasonic S Series Type V electrolytic capacitors are AEC-Q200 qualified and suitable for use in automotive applications. These Panasonic electrolytic capacitors are recommended for use in industrial infrastructure in motor drivers, inverters, measuring instruments, power supplies, HEMS, BEMS and FEMS. Other suitable applications include ICT applications such as PCs, base stations, data centres, non-contact charge. S Series Type V aluminium capacitors can be utilised in home appliances including air conditioners, white goods and home information appliances. Other uses include lighting, OA equipment, electric tools, medical equipment and power management, safety, infotainment and comfort accessories in automotive applications.
